Chapter 3

Critically reviewing the literature

ByDileesha Sandeepana

To conduct a ‘preliminary’ search of existing material.

To organize valuable ideas & findings.

To identify other researches that may be in progress.

To generate research ideas.

To develop a critical perspective.

Reasons for reviewing literature

The literature review process

Deductive:

Developing a conceptual frame work which is tested using data.

Inductive:

Explores the data to develop theories which is then subsequently relate to the literature.
